Space Invaders plus two for XBLA

Tomorrow's trio also features zombies.

Microsoft has said to expect three new Xbox Live Arcade games tomorrow - Space Invaders Extreme and Arkanoid Live! from Square-owned Taito, and Zombie Wranglers from Activision. All three will cost 800 Microsoft Points (GBP 6.80 / EUR 9.60).

Already seen on PSP and DS, Space Invaders Extreme is a disco-dancing update to the classic eighties shoot-'em-up, featuring a new, in-depth scoring mechanic based on shooting certain enemy colour combinations. We thought it was great on handhelds.

We didn't think that about Arkanoid Live!, but everyone gets a second chance. It's a Breakout update, with 62 rounds, online play, and a difficult-to-read logo.

Finally there's Zombie Wranglers, a former Vivendi game developed by Frozen Codebase. We've already had one excellent zombie game this week - are we about to get another?
